Azure infrastructure cloud solution architect (csa)

Microsoft
Infrastructure
Posted: 13 May
Offer description

Overview As an Azure Infrastructure Cloud Solution Architect (CSA) within the Customer Success Unit (CSU), you will serve as the senior technical advisor and delivery lead for Federal Government and Defence customers. You are responsible for designing, enabling, and optimizing secure, resilient, and compliant Azure environments that support mission-critical workloads in highly regulated environments (e.g., ISM, PSPF). This is a customer-facing, outcome-driven role where you: Lead technical delivery execution across Azure infrastructure Enable secure cloud adoption at scale Drive Azure consumption, reliability, and long-term platform strategies Partner across Microsoft (CSAM, Engineering, Support) to deliver end-to-end customer success In the FDI context, you play a critical role in: Supporting secure cloud transformation programs (e.g. Defence platforms, Gov modernization) Enabling AI-ready infrastructure in classified and regulated environments Building trusted advisory relationships with senior government stakeholders Responsibilities Secure Platform Delivery & Execution Lead the deployment and stabilization of Azure infrastructure environments (landing zones, networking, governance frameworks) Remove blockers impacting mission-critical delivery milestones Ensure environments meet security, compliance, and accreditation requirements (ISM, PSPF) Support and resolve technical incidents in partnership with Microsoft Support and Engineering Architecture & Cloud Platform Design Design scalable, secure Azure infrastructure architectures aligned to Government and Defence standards Build repeatable platform patterns for multi-workload environments (Defence platforms, shared services, etc.) Enable transition from pilot to production-grade, enterprise-scale deployments Support hybrid and sovereign scenarios using Azure-native and hybrid capabilities Consumption & Adoption Growth Enable workload onboarding and accelerate Azure usage through platform readiness Reduce friction between design and deployment to drive sustained consumption growth Ensure environments are optimized for performance, cost, and operational efficiency Drive confidence for customers to continue investing in Azure Technical Leadership & Advisory Act as a trusted advisor to customer technical and executive stakeholders Deliver proactive services including: Architecture reviews Technical assessments Workshops aligned to cloud adoption and modernization Provide guidance on secure cloud adoption and operational best practices Influence long-term technology strategy and roadmaps Customer Success Planning & Stakeholder Alignment Contribute to and execute Customer Success Plans (CSPs) in partnership with CSAMs Maintain visibility of delivery status, risks, and outcomes (RAID) Support executive engagement forums (QBRs, governance boards, technical design authorities) Align Microsoft teams to drive One Microsoft execution across Defence and Government accounts Operational Excellence, Security & Resilience Ensure customer platforms meet high standards of security, resiliency, and governance Lead practices across: Monitoring and observability Disaster recovery and business continuity Cost and performance optimization Enable AI-ready environments for future transformation initiatives Qualifications Required/minimum qualifications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, Business, Liberal Arts, or related field AND 4 years experience in cloud/infrastructure technologies, information technology (IT) consulting/support, systems administration, network operations, software development/support, technology solutions, practice development, architecture, and/or consulting OR equivalent experience. Technical Expertise Deep experience across Azure Infrastructure, including: Virtual Machines, compute, and scaling Networking (hybrid connectivity, security architectures) Storage, backup, and disaster recovery (ASR / Backup) Monitoring and observability (Azure Monitor / Insights) Governance and compliance (Azure Policy, RBAC, landing zones) Strong understanding of hybrid cloud and sovereign architectures Experience designing production-grade, secure enterprise environments Security & Compliance (Critical for FDI) Experience working with regulated environments (Government / Defence preferred) Knowledge of: ISM (Information Security Manual) PSPF (Protective Security Policy Framework) Security accreditation and compliance processes Ability to design and guide secure-by-design cloud architectures Delivery & Execution Capability Proven ability to: Lead complex technical delivery engagements Troubleshoot and resolve critical platform issues Enable delivery teams to meet committed milestones Strong operational discipline across: Risk management Delivery planning Stakeholder communication Customer & Stakeholder Skills Ability to engage: Technical teams (engineers, architects) Executive stakeholders (CIO, CTO, Heads of Engineering) Strong communication and influencing skills Experience working in matrixed, multi-team environments This position requires verification of Australian Citizenship due to citizenship based legal restrictions. Specifically, this position supports federal, state and /or local Australian government agency customers and is subject to certain citizenship-based restrictions where required or permitted by law. To meet this legal requirement, and as a condition of employment, the successful candidate’s citizenship will be verified with a valid passport.
